#Fellowship Opportunity 📚|| Are you studying in the field of Economics particularly Agricultural Economics, or Development Economics? ILRI, on behalf of the International Water Management Institute (IWMI), is hiring a Research Fellow to examine how water bunds affect the livelihoods in the pastoral regions of Kajiado County, Kenya, along with conducting research on irrigation water tariffs in various Kenyan irrigation schemes.
Requirements:
🎓 Master's in Economics, Agricultural Economics, Development Economics, or related field
📊 Experience with quant + qual data collection and analysis
🏛️ Must be affiliated with a National Agricultural Research Institute/university
What you get: 4-month fellowship, monthly stipend, medical insurance, based in Nairobi.
💚IMVELO Impact: In this role, you will design data collection tools, run CAPI surveys, clean and analyze data in STATA, work with qualitative data in NVivo, and co-author research outputs like blogs, technical briefs, and working papers. You will acquire real fieldwork expertise, work with real data for real policy relevance — the kind of research experience that goes far beyond the classroom.
